Ethan Allen Announces Strengthening of Leadership Structure

Ethan Allen Interiors Inc. (“Ethan Allen” or the “Company”) announced the promotion of key leaders. Corey Whitely has been promoted to the position of Executive Vice President, Operations and will be responsible for the Company’s operations including manufacturing, logistics and technology. Flexsteel Industries, Inc. Provides Business Update for Fiscal Second Quarter 2022

Flexsteel Industries, Inc. (“Flexsteel” or the “Company”), one of the largest manufacturers, importers and online marketers of furniture products in the United States, today provided several updates on recent business conditions impacting its fiscal 2022 second quarter. International Paper to Build State-of-the-Art Corrugated Packaging Plant in Atglen, Pennsylvania

International Paper announced it will build a state-of-the-art corrugated packaging plant in Atglen, Pennsylvania. The facility will employ approximately 150 team members. “We are excited to expand our footprint and continue serving our customers with the highest level of safety, quality, operational excellence and customer service,” said Greg Wanta, senior vice president, North American Container. Kamps, Inc. Acquires Tritz Pallet, Inc.

Kamps, Inc. (“Kamps”, “Company”), one of the nation’s largest pallet recyclers, is pleased to announce that on December 13th it acquired Tritz Pallet, Inc. (“Tritz”). Tritz is a pallet recycler and full-service pallet solutions provider with seven asset-based locations across the Plains region. PPG Appoints New Chief Operating Officer

PPG announced the appointment of Tim Knavish, executive vice president, as chief operating officer, effective March 1, 2022. Knavish will have executive oversight responsibility for all of PPG’s strategic business units and operating regions and for the information technology (“IT”), environment, health and safety (“EH&S”), and procurement functions. Mortgage Applications Decrease in December 15th MBA Weekly Survey

Mortgage applications decreased 4.0 percent from one week earlier, according to data from the Mortgage Bankers Association’s (MBA) Weekly Mortgage Applications Survey for the week ending December 10, 2021. Madison’s Reporter: Current Lumber Price Trendline Matches 2020

The extent of damage to transportation infrastructure and supply chain in southern British Columbia following the massive flooding in November is now known. After closing down two times, the Port of Vancouver is now fully re-open, as both railways are running again.
